The Editors of Encyclopaedia Britannica Last Updated: Jul 19, 2024 • Article History Table of Contents Also known as: Asia-Pacific (Show more) Indo-Pacific, maritime region spanning the Indian and Pacific oceans that has become a significant focal point of geopolitical strategy and tension throughout the 21st century. The term has been widely adopted in policy discourse by the United States and its allies, including Australia, Japan, South Korea, India, France, the United Kingdom, Germany, and the countries of ASEAN (Association of Southeast Asian Nations). Although Russia and China also prioritize the region strategically, they generally prefer the older term “Asia-Pacific.” While there is broad agreement on the general area of the Indo-Pacific, various countries interpret its exact boundaries differently, reflecting their unique ...(100 of 1209 words)
